Technically, MRDN is showing signs of short-term weakness. The stock is trading below its 20‑day moving average and may be approaching its 50‑day moving average, depending on the speed of the decline. The relative strength index (RSI) has likely dropped into the low‑to‑mid 40s, reflecting increasing bearish momentum without yet reaching oversold territory. Support at $9.44 represents a critical level—this area has acted as a floor in previous pullbacks, and a break below it could open the door to further losses toward the next significant support zone. On the upside, resistance remains firmly at $10.44, a level that has contained rallies in recent sessions. The price action on the daily chart shows a series of lower highs and lower lows since the stock peaked near $10.44, confirming a short‑term downtrend. Volume patterns are consistent with distribution, as sell‑offs have been accompanied by above‑average turnover. Traders may look for a bullish reversal pattern—such as a hammer candlestick or a morning star—near the $9.44 support to suggest exhaustion of selling pressure. Until such a pattern emerges, the bias remains tilted to the downside. Looking ahead, MRDN’s near‑term trajectory will likely depend on whether the $9.44 support holds. If buyers defend this level, a bounce back toward $10.00 and eventually $10.44 could materialize, particularly if sector sentiment improves or company‑specific catalysts emerge. However, if the support breaks, the stock could slip to lower levels, possibly into the $9.00–$9.20 range, where prior consolidation occurred. Factors that may influence future performance include any corporate announcements, earnings reports, or changes in the broader market environment. The stock’s low price and small market cap may also lead to higher volatility, making technical levels even more critical. Investors should monitor volume patterns and price action around the support for clues about the next move. A sustained close above $10.44 would negate the current bearish outlook, while a close below $9.44 would reinforce the downtrend.
